  2. Dictionary

    slump
    [sləmp]
    verb
    slump (verb) · slumps (third person present) · slumped (past tense) · slumped (past participle) · slumping (present participle)
    1. sit, lean, or fall heavily and limply, especially with a bent back:
      "she slumped against the cushions" · "Denis was slumped in his seat"
    2. undergo a sudden severe or prolonged fall in price, value, or amount:
      "land prices slumped"
      Opposite:
    noun
    slump (noun) · slumps (plural noun)
    1. a sudden severe or prolonged fall in the price, value, or amount of something:
      "a slump in annual profits"
      Opposite:
    Origin
    late 17th century (in the sense ‘fall into a bog’): probably imitative and related to Norwegian slumpe ‘to fall’.
